What is digital marketing? What are the basics of Digital Marketing?
All online marketing initiatives and actions that use digital platforms and technologies to promote goods or services are collectively referred to as digital marketing In order to reach and interact with a target audience, develop brand awareness, increase website traffic, and eventually accomplish commercial objectives, it involves a variety of online platforms, tools, and tactics. Here are some fundamentals of digital marketing and a synopsis of its approach.
Basics of Digital Marketing:
Website: A well-designed and user-friendly website is the foundation of digital marketing. It serves as the central hub for all online activities.
Search Engine Optimization (SEO): SEO involves optimizing your website and content to rank higher in search engine results pages (SERPs), making it easier for people to find your site organically.
Content Marketing: Creating and distributing valuable, relevant content (e.g., blog posts, videos, infographics) to attract and engage your target audience.
Social Media Marketing: Using social media platforms (e.g.,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, LinkedIn) to build a brand presence, connect with the audience, and drive traffic to your website.
Email Marketing: Sending targeted emails to your subscribers to nurture leads, promote products, and maintain customer relationships.
Pay-Per-Click (PPC) Advertising: Running paid ads on platforms like Google Ads or social media to drive immediate traffic and conversions.
Affiliate Marketing: Partnering with affiliates or influencers to promote your products or services in exchange for a commission.
Analytics and Data Analysis: Utilizing tools like Google Analytics to measure the effectiveness of your campaigns and make data-driven decisions.
Digital Marketing Strategy:
A digital marketing strategy is a comprehensive plan that outlines how you will achieve your marketing goals using various digital channels. It involves the following key steps:
Set Clear Objectives: Define specific, measurable, and achievable goals (e.g., increasing website traffic by 20% in six months).
Target Audience: Identify your ideal customer personas and their online behaviors.
Choose Digital Channels: Determine which digital channels (e.g., SEO, social media, email) are most relevant to your audience and goals.
Content Strategy: Plan the type of content you'll create and how it aligns with your audience's needs and preferences.
Budget Allocation: Allocate your budget to different channels and campaigns based on their potential ROI.
Implementation: Execute your marketing activities according to your plan.
Monitor and Measure: Continuously track and analyze your campaign's performance to make necessary adjustments.
Optimization: Use the data you collect to optimize your campaigns and improve results over time.
Who Needs Digital Marketing Services?
Digital marketing services are beneficial for a wide range of businesses and organizations, including:
Small Businesses: Digital marketing can level the playing field for small businesses by providing cost-effective ways to reach a global audience.
E-commerce Businesses: Online retailers can use digital marketing to boost sales, increase website traffic, and build brand loyalty.
Startups: Digital marketing can help startups create brand awareness and acquire customers quickly.
Large Corporations: Established companies use digital marketing to maintain their online presence, engage with customers, and adapt to changing market trends.
Nonprofits: Nonprofit organizations can leverage digital marketing to raise awareness, attract donors, and advocate for their causes.
Individuals and Influencers: Personal branding and influencers can benefit from digital marketing to grow their online presence and monetize their platforms.
